What is the average loan amount at Livingstone College?

For the academic year 2022-2023, total 177 full-time, first-time students (79% of all freshmen) have received student loans (federal or other source). For all undergraduate students, total 816 students (88% of all students) have received federal student loans and the average loan amount is $7,692 at Livingstone College.
